Deep Dive into Server Memory Architecture: From DRAM Granules to NUMA Modes

Starting from the physical structure of DRAM granules, this article analyzes core concepts including Channel, Rank, Bank, Burst, and Prefetch layer by layer. Combined with the real CPU architectures of Intel Emerald Rapids (EMR) MCC/XCC and Granite Rapids (GNR) XCC, it explores the working principles, performance differences, and tuning recommendations for UMA, NUMA, SNC2/SNC4, Hemisphere, and Quadrant memory clustering modes.

Read More